Nokia Advances Share Buyback Plan

Nokia (GB:0HAF) has released an update.

Nokia Corporation has executed the repurchase of its own shares on July 19, 2024, acquiring 2,949,127 shares at an average price of EUR 3.37 per share, under a share buyback program announced earlier that year. The program, aimed at returning up to EUR 600 million to shareholders, is part of a two-year plan, with this phase involving up to EUR 300 million by December 2024. Following the transaction, Nokia now holds over 115 million treasury shares.
